Def in top 10. I love QS but he is still learning from my perspective and not COY candidate. Gets props for adjusting from season 1 to 2. Last year they needed to understand their weaknesses and get passionate about fixing them. They needed to understand how hard a long NBA season is. Needed an occasional stare down or butt kicking for effort and focus. This year it is building confidence and maintaining progress on development. He clearly has control of the team, not an easy task. He needs to help establish a culture where he has stronger player-leaders. Their leadership situation is too diffuse, there should be a clear set of players who are in control of the locker room, such as the Pistons and Isiah and Laimbeer, who laid down the culture "this is how we do business on this team"
